Principal Payment Tech Development Manager

The Principal Payment Tech Development Manager will lead the end-to-end design, development, testing, certification, and delivery of contact/contactless chip technologies, mobile payments, and other emerging payment devices. A critical focus of this role includes leading the development of card- and wallet-related functional and security requirements, consult on test plans, and test tools necessary for executing D-PAS card personalization and Mobile D-PAS Wallet validations—both of which are vital prerequisites for successful D-PAS product acceptance. The Manager will act as a key technical contributor to product specifications (functional and security features), manage strategic vendor relationships, and proactively mitigate risks or customer-impacting issues.

Core Responsibilities:

  • Technology Design & Product Development
  • Lead Innovation: Manage, design, and develop new payment technologies for both card acceptance devices and payment devices (including contact/contactless chips, mobile, and cloud-based payments)
  • Define Specifications: Contribute to the development of product technology specifications, focusing heavily on functional and security features.
  • Testing, Certification & Compliance
  • Framework Development: Create and maintain comprehensive testing requirements, test plans, and procedures for new payment technology products.
  • Validation Ownership: Lead the debugging of the technology products using L2 tools required for the effective execution of type approval of the product
  • Compliance Program Design: Advise on establishing certification requirements and compliance programs to ensure seamless, standardized product rollouts.
  • Vendor & Partner Management
  • Strategic Partnerships: Manage relationships with external vendors, including card and chip manufacturers, test laboratories, test tool providers, and mobile application developers.
  • Quality Assurance: Oversee external partners to ensure the delivery of high-quality services and tools that align with corporate standards.
  • Industry Standards & Stakeholder Collaboration
  • Standards Alignment: Manage and participate in the development of payment specifications within relevant global standardization organizations.
  • Cross-Functional Communication: Educate, communicate, and collaborate with internal and external stakeholders regarding new and updated payment standards and specifications.
  • Risk Management & Operations
  • Proactive Mitigation: Actively manage, mitigate, and elevate risks or customer-impacting issues to senior management during day-to-day operations.

Basic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ma, GED or equivalent certification
  • At least 5 years of payment technology research and development experience
  • At least 2 years of experience supporting, partnering and interacting with internal or external business clients

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's or Master’s Degree in Engineering, Computer Science or Technology
  • Experience working with EMV payments systems, mobile payment technologies including cloud-based payments and secure elements
  • Deep understanding of EMV Functional requirements and EMV Security requirements
